New Middle Sand Trend Confirmed Over 2,500 Feet
Kelowna, British Columbia–(Newsfile Corp. – May 5, 2026) – Strathmore Plus Uranium Corporation (CSE: SUU) (OTCQB: SUUFF) (FSE: TO3)(“Strathmore” or “the Company“) is pleased to announce strong results from its Spring 2026 exploration drilling program at the Agate Project in Wyoming’s prolific Shirley Basin District. Drilling successfully delineated a new Middle Sand mineralized trend over 2,500 feet and extended the existing Lower Sand trend an additional 1,000 feet westward.
Agate sits directly adjacent to projects held by Cameco and UEC and lies next to UR-Energy’s satellite in-situ recovery (ISR) mine, which is now producing, as of April 23. Mineralization at Agate is shallow (20–150 feet), largely below the water table, and ideally suited for low-cost ISR recovery.
The company completed 48 holes and delivered a strong 81% mineralization hit rate (with 39 of 48 holes above cutoff grade), targeting on-trend mineralization previously defined by Strathmore, twinning of historical drill holes, and exploration in areas of sparse historical drilling which showed potential for mineralization in the middle sand, the main source of historically mined uranium in Shirley Basin.

New Mineralized Middle Trend: Exploration drilling to the north of the previously defined lower sand trend encountered middle sand mineralization across a trend length over 2,500 feet and is highlighted by drill holes AG-274-26 (95-111 ft, 16.0 ft @ 0.071% eU3O8) and AG-292-26 (81.5-96ft, 14.5 ft @ 0.063% eU3O8). Mineralization appears open to both the west and east. Future exploration will target this newly discovered trend with the intent to expand its width and length.
Extended Mineralized Lower Trend: Exploration to the west of the previously defined lower sand trend extended the mineralization westward by 1,000 feet, to now nearly 6,000 feet in length. The drilling on this lower sand trend was highlighted by drill holes AG-283-26 (90.5-93.5 ft, 13 ft @ 0.049% eU3O8) and AG-289-26 (82-86 ft, 4 ft @ 0.102% eU3O8).
These results confirm excellent continuity of the classic Wyoming roll-front system and significantly expand the mineralized footprint at Agate.
Strathmore will now advance permitting the project with the completion and submittal of a Plan of Operation with US Bureau of Land Management and the Wyoming Department of Environmental Quality.

Note. The geophysical results are based on equivalent uranium (eU3O8) of the gamma-ray probes calibrated at the Department of Energy’s Test Facility in Casper, Wyoming. A geophysical tool with gamma-ray, spontaneous potential, resistivity, and drift detectors was utilized. The reader is cautioned that the reported uranium grades may not reflect actual concentrations due to the potential for disequilibrium between uranium and its gamma emitting daughter products.
- Mineralized holes with thicker, higher-grade intercepts are interpreted to be in the Near Interface, Nose (main front), or Near Seepage ground located within the projected roll front system.
- Mineralized holes with thinner, below cutoff grade intercepts are interpreted to be in the Limb/Tails or Remote Seepage ground located behind (altered) or ahead (reduced) of the projected roll front system, respectively.
- The drill results were determined using thickness and grade % cutoffs of 2-ft and 0.01% eU3O8.

About the Agate Property
The Agate property consists of 124 wholly owned lode mining claims covering ~2,560 acres. Uranium mineralization is contained in classic Wyoming-type roll fronts within the Eocene Wind River Formation, an arkosic-rich sandstone. Historically, 53 million pounds of uranium were mined in Shirley Basin, including from open-pit, underground, and the first commercial in-situ recovery operation in the USA during the 1960s. At the property, the uranium mineralization is shallow, from 20 to approximately 150 feet deep, much of which appears below the water table and likely amenable to in-situ recovery. Kerr McGee Corporation, the largest US uranium mining company at the time, completed extensive drilling across the greater project area in the 1970s, delineating areas of historical resources and potential mineralization. Strathmore has completed 294 holes during the 2023-26 drilling programs, including installation of five monitor wells for groundwater studies and recovery of core for chemical assays and XRF analysis at the University of Wyoming.
About Strathmore Plus Uranium Corp. Strathmore is focused on discovering uranium deposits in Wyoming, and has three permitted uranium projects including Agate, Beaver Rim, and Night Owl. The Agate and Beaver Rim properties contain uranium in typical Wyoming-type roll front deposits based on historical drilling data. The Night Owl property is a former producing surface mine that was in production in the early 1960s.
